| Property | Test Method | Typical Value (Kaxite Seals Premium Grade) |
|---|---|---|
| Density | ASTM D792 | 2.15 - 2.20 g/cm³ |
| Tensile Strength | ASTM D638 | 25 - 35 MPa (3,600 - 5,000 PSI) |
| Elongation at Break | ASTM D638 | 300 - 500% |
| Melting Point | ASTM D4591 | 327°C (621°F) |
| Coefficient of Friction (Dynamic) | ASTM D1894 | 0.05 - 0.08 |
| Dielectric Strength | ASTM D149 | >60 kV/mm |
| Water Absorption | ASTM D570 | < 0.01% |

What is the primary difference between PTFE, FEP, and PFA tubing?
PTFE, FEP (Fluorinated Ethylene Propylene), and PFA (Perfluoroalkoxy) are all fluoropolymers. PTFE has the highest continuous use temperature (260°C) and best chemical resistance but is opaque and more difficult to thermoform. FEP is translucent, melt-processable, and has a lower temp rating (200°C). PFA offers clarity similar to FEP, a high temp rating (260°C), and excellent chemical resistance, often used for high-purity liquid handling. Kaxite Seals can help you select the optimal material.
Can Kaxite Seals PTFE Tube be used for steam applications?
While PTFE has excellent temperature resistance, prolonged exposure to high-pressure, high-temperature steam (e.g., >150°C at significant pressure) can lead to gradual degradation over time. For intermittent or low-pressure steam services, it may be suitable. For critical continuous steam applications, we recommend consulting our engineers for a detailed assessment and potential alternative material suggestions.
How do I connect and fit PTFE tubing? What fittings are compatible?
PTFE tubing is relatively flexible but not elastomeric. Common connection methods include using compression fittings (e.g., Swagelok®, Parker CPI), push-to-connect fittings, or barbed fittings with hose clamps. For a leak-tight seal with compression fittings, it's crucial to use ferrules designed for PTFE or use a combination of a PTFE sleeve with a standard metal ferrule. Over-tightening should be avoided to prevent crushing the tube wall.

What are the sterilization options for your PTFE tubing in pharmaceutical or food use?
Kaxite Seals PTFE Tube is compatible with all common sterilization methods. It can withstand repeated cycles of autoclaving (steam sterilization at 121-134°C), dry heat, gamma irradiation, and Ethylene Oxide (EtO) treatment without significant loss of properties. Its non-porous surface prevents bacterial entrapment, supporting cleanability and sterility.
How should I store PTFE tubing, and what is its shelf life?
Store the tubing in its original packaging in a cool, dry, dark place away from direct sunlight and heat sources. Avoid extreme bending or crushing during storage. Properly stored, PTFE tubing has an essentially indefinite shelf life as it does not degrade under normal ambient conditions. Its material properties remain stable for decades.
